Description:
The Norway program offers students the opportunity to enroll at the University of Oslo in a wide range of courses taught in English in a variety of disciplines. Students can take courses in such areas as Scandinavian Studies, Economics, Natural Science, Mathematics, Social Science, Media and Technology, and Literature. Students have the option of taking an Intensive Beginners' Course in Norwegian in addition to their normal study program.
Highlights:
Surrounded by hills and fjords, the University of Oslo is Norway's largest and oldest university and leading academic institution. International students are offered a "Special Events Program" each semester. The events provide cultural and social opportunities and will assist you in meeting local and other international students and in becoming integrated into the university community. Special events are either free or very reasonably priced and include a tour of Oslo, guided visits to art galleries and museums, film evenings, the very popular International Coffee Hour on Friday afternoons, a cross-country skiing course, and fall and spring weekend trips into the beautiful forests of Nordmarka, part of Oslo's extensive recreation area. International students can also take part in the many student clubs and societies open to all registered students at the University of Oslo. The city has many cafes and bars where there is nightly entertainment as well as theaters and concert halls, and the countryside surrounding Oslo is spectacularly beautiful and offers opportunities for both downhill and cross country skiing as well as hiking, orienteering, and biking.

Cost in US$: Semester: USD 4,980 ; Year: USD 9,960
Cost Include Description:
- Tuition and fees - admission fee to host university - personalized pre-departure advising - immigration visa assistance - parental support and consultation - financial aid and scholarship assistance - transcript assistance - student health insurance - University of Oslo orientation in Oslo, Beginners course in Norwegian
